13 ways Google Cloud beats AWS

The typical general public is aware of what the term “google” usually means. It is a search motor, although there’s also Gmail and some providers like Google Maps. But which is about it. 

Developers know that powering the scenes, many decades back, the company started constructing a single of the initial cloud providers to help these significant web pages that run at a planet-wide scale. It was an amazing engineering feat. Now the very same software program and components that powers their fantastic search and promotion empire can also help your company, compact or substantial. It is just a click away.

The cloud company might be dominated by Amazon and its ever growing assortment of dozens of solutions and providers, but Google is running hard. From time to time they’re catching up and occasionally they could be said to be top.

Major? Effectively, it is hard to say that some cloud solutions are head-and-shoulders above others because the solutions on their own are typically commodities. A machine running the recent model of Ubuntu or a cloud storage bucket that merchants a handful of gigabytes are about as interchangeable as evenings spent at home for the duration of quarantine.

Nevertheless, the cloud companies are finding techniques to differentiate on their own with further capabilities and, as is additional typically the scenario, a bit unique techniques. Google’s cloud solutions have a design and style all of their own, a design and style that echoes the highly effective simplicity of several of Google’s buyer-going through solutions.

Some of this design and style is evident as quickly as you log in because several of the instruments are not much too unique from the extensively used G Suite. The user interface has the very same major hues and thoroughly clean design and style as the main customer-going through applications like Gmail. Finding your way through the maze of configuration screens is a lot like finding your way through Google’s workplace programs or search screens. Less is additional.

There are discrepancies beneath much too. The company’s interior tech culture has normally been described by a fantastic devotion to open source. As this culture advanced, it created a selected Googly flavor that is additional and additional evident when you go to the cloud. There are stable open source selections like Kubernetes and Ubuntu just about everywhere. And when Google crafted a single of the very first serverless instruments, the App Motor, it started with a toy scripting language, Python. Now the Python language and the serverless approach are just about everywhere. This tradition of crystal clear and open instruments is uncovered all over each and every corner.

Nevertheless, below are thirteen techniques Google Cloud shines just a little bit brighter than AWS.

Google Chrome Business

When the COVID-19 lockdowns began, the companies relying on Chrome Business uncovered it a little bit much easier to get absolutely everyone functioning from home because all of the cloud providers are crafted all over an open normal running really a lot just about everywhere. There is no want to restrict your workforce to any specific model or model. To make it even much easier and additional predictable, Google distributes Chrome for a wide range of working methods for laptops, desktops, and cell telephones. 

This very same “web as working system” technique leaks about to the cloud providers. Though you’ll probably be looking for generic devices running generic working methods, you’ll be working with instruments and interfaces that play a little bit superior with the Chrome ecosystem. Your workforce does not want to run a specific VPN or set up remote access. It does not want to restrict alone to a specific OS. Almost everything runs in the browser.

Applications Script

Do macros created for a spreadsheet rely as genuine software program progress? Or are they just some thing a talented non-programmer learns to do? Applications Script is a macro-like layer in the Google cloud that will allow JavaScript programmers to link together all of the Google applications. A file button will view your actions and transform the measures into code, producing it a lot less difficult to thread together the G Suite applications than constructing out some elaborate container. If your job is easy, a little bit of Applications Script might be more than enough to get your job performed. If your job is a little bit additional elaborate, you still could want to generate the closing measures for presentation with Applications Script because you can. If the users are living in G Suite applications, then Applications Script can be the simplest way to develop some thing that fulfills them in which they’re cozy.

AppSheet

When cloud providers get even larger, people today want to link them together. In the past, that meant plenty of custom code but points are finding less difficult for absolutely everyone. Google’s AppSheet is a “no code” possibility that will link together the dominant providers like Google Analytics and the G Suite. Contacting it “no code” might not be fully proper, but the instruments for workflows, industry inspection, and reporting go a extensive way to doing most of what you’ll probably want to do. The sections are all there in the Google cloud and now it is much easier to link them together without having stressing about syntax and scope difficulties that go along with textual content-primarily based code.

Health and fitness Treatment API

If you are in the company of holding people today healthier, Google’s Health and fitness Treatment API has extra a layer of perfectly-tuned code to preserve you the time of composing it on your own. The API supports several of the important requirements for guarding affected individual privacy and nurturing their wellness like HIPPA, HL7 FHIR, HL7 v2, and DICOM. Beneath lies the electricity of the additional essential solutions like BigQuery in scenario you want to generate code that connects at a reduced stage.

Anthos

It is a little bit unfair to feel of Anthos as some thing which is one of a kind to the Google Cloud Platform because it is marketed as a platform for multicloud progress and distribution. It is previously running on AWS and it is getting previewed in Azure. Nevertheless, the notion arrived from Google Cloud and it continues to be a big part of Google’s vision for the cloud upcoming.

The Anthos model is an umbrella for Google’s hybrid vision in which digital devices will morph into containers and then circulation between Kubernetes pods. The Migrate for Anthos tool will transform an outdated stack running in a VM into a container ready for modern Kubernetes deployment possibly in the local cloud in your server room or in any of the Anthos-running general public clouds out there. A wonderful provider mesh layered on best can make it much easier to deploy and debug microservices. Security and id guidelines are managed uniformly conserving builders from shouldering that perform.

Firebase

Google Cloud Platform features a selection of unique techniques to shop details, but a single of the selections, Firebase, is a little bit unique from the frequent database. Firebase does not just shop details. It also replicates the details to other copies of the database, which can involve purchasers, in particular cell purchasers. In other terms, Firebase handles all of the pushing (and pulling) from the purchasers to the servers. You can generate your client code and just think that the details it needs will magically appear when it is offered. 

Pushing new variations of the details to absolutely everyone who needs a copy is a single of the largest complications for cell builders and genuinely any individual constructing distributed and interconnected applications. You have got to maintain all of these connections up just to press a little bit of new details each and every so typically.

Firebase might seem and seem like a database, but genuinely it is a cell progress platform with an growing assortment of extensions and integrations with other platforms. It has a lot of the composition you could want to create distributed world wide web or cell applications. Or cell world wide web applications for that subject.

Embedded machine studying

Yes, BigQuery and Firebase are identified as databases, but they’re also machine studying powerhouse. You can get started off storing your details and then, if your manager would like some evaluation, just kick off the machine studying routines with the very same tables. You will not want to move the details or repack it for some individual machine studying toolkit. It all stays in a single location, a function that will preserve you from composing loads of glue code. And then, as an further-extra reward for the SQL jockeys who travel databases, the machine studying in BigQuery is invoked with an extra keyword to the SQL dialect. You can do the perform of an AI scientist with the language of a DBA. In the meantime, Firebase builders can play to that database’s energy and invoke ML Package for Firebase, a tool that brings the machine studying to the details stored domestically in an Android or iOS device. 

G Suite integration

It is no surprise that Google features some integration of its cloud platform solutions with its essential workplace solutions. Right after all, the Googlers use the G Suite all over the company and they want to get at the details much too. BigQuery, for occasion, features many techniques to access and assess your details by turning it into a Sheets document in Google Travel. Or you can take your Sheets details and move it immediately into a BigQuery database. If your group is previously utilizing the unique G Suite applications, there’s a great chance it will be a little bit less difficult to shop your details and code in the Google Cloud. There are dozens of connections and pathways that make the integration a little bit less difficult.

Far more digital CPUs

The past time we appeared at the documentation, AWS EC2 occasions maxed out at 96 vCPUs. Google Cloud’s list of devices consists of some in which the selection of digital CPUs needs three digits. And then there’s the m2-ultramem-4164, a monster with 416 digital CPUs and eleven,776 gigabytes of RAM. Of study course, the CPUs are not exactly the very same electricity and they virtually certainly run some benchmarks at unique speeds. In addition incorporating additional digital CPUs does not normally make your software program go more quickly. The only genuine measure is the throughput on your dilemma. But if you want to brag about booting up a machine with 416 CPUs, now is your chance!

Custom made cloud devices

Google lets you opt for how several digital CPUs and how a lot RAM your occasion will get. AWS has several selections and a single of them is sure to be really near to what you want, but which is not the very same as getting definitely custom, is it? Google features sliders that allow you be a little bit additional specific and opt for, say, twelve vCPUs and seventy four GB of RAM. Or possibly you want 14 vCPUs. If so, Google will accommodate you.

There are limitations to this overall flexibility, though. Never aspiration about infinite precision because the slider tends to stick on even quantities. You simply cannot opt for thirteen vCPUs, for occasion, which would probably be unfortunate in any case. Some categories of devices like the N2D demand the rely of digital CPUs to be multiples of four, and if you get started finding greedy by constructing a big, excess fat machine, the policies insist that you take in vCPUs in blocks of sixteen. But this is still a fantastic raise in overall flexibility if you want a unusual configuration or you want to provision exactly the minimal amount of money of RAM to get the job performed.

A top quality community

Google and Amazon have massive networks that link their details facilities but only Google has a individual “premium” community. It is like a distinctive rapid lane for top quality customers that arrives with some dependability and effectiveness ensures like N+two redundancy and at the very least three paths in between details facilities. If you want to count on the Google CDN and load balancing across unique details facilities, then opting for the top quality community will make daily life a little bit smoother for your details flows.

What about the non-top quality users? Do their packets vacation by burro and carrier pigeon? No, but accepting less ensures arrives with a reduced selling price tag. By opening up this possibility, Google lets us make your mind up whether or not we want to fork out additional for more quickly world details motion or preserve income by finding by with perhaps an occasional hiccup. It is not a different possibility to muddle our brains. It is an prospect.

Pre-emptible occasions

New visits to sites want an instant response, but a fantastic offer of the track record processing and housekeeping all over most sites does not want to get performed appropriate away. It does not even want to get performed in the future handful of hrs. It just needs to be performed finally.

Google features some thing identified as pre-emptible occasions that come at a wonderful price cut. The catch is that Google reserves the appropriate to shut down your occasion and put it aside if an individual or some thing additional important arrives along and would like the methods. They’ll get started it up once again afterwards when the demand for computation drops.

AWS features a unique way to preserve on compute fees, a market in which you can bid for methods and use them only if you post a profitable higher bid. This is fantastic if you’ve got the time to view the auctions and alter your bids if the perform is not finding performed, but it is not fantastic if you’ve got additional important points to do. Google has come up with a system that rewards you for volunteering to be bumped and matches it with a selling price which is locked in. No confusion.

Sustained use bargains

A further wonderful function of the Google Cloud Platform is the way that the bargains just exhibit up quickly the additional you use your devices. Your compute occasions get started off the month at whole selling price and then the charges get started dropping. You really don’t want to maintain the devices running continually because the selling price is set by your utilization for the month. If your occasion is up for about 50 percent of the month, the price cut is about 10 %. If you depart your occasion up from the very first to past day, you’ll close up conserving thirty % off the whole selling price.

By the way, Google techniques this pricing like a pc scientist. It tracks how several vCPUs and how a lot memory you’ve used between the many machine sorts and then brings together the unique devices, in which doable, to give you an even even larger price cut. Google calls this “inferred occasions.” The model is a little bit complicated but pretty practical if you are constantly starting off and halting multiple devices.

AWS also features bargains, but the selling price breaks increase to these who pre-invest in reserved devices or bid on the place marketplaces. They also provide some tiered bargains that reward substantial users, and these could perform, in some perception, like sustained use bargains. But you really a lot want to make a determination. Google just rewards you.

Copyright © 2020 IDG Communications, Inc.